Output 1d63680d327e44e92bfd978dc69d8a381aacd5a3994274a432ae290c8ff72f8a:11

value
1008882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735da2c37dd1289ad23f4a6a6371b07e14461d41 OP_EQUAL
address
3CD1oXtXzq3H4icbjuaMapFkDjBJCH7wTA
transaction
1d63680d327e44e92bfd978dc69d8a381aacd5a3994274a432ae290c8ff72f8a
spent
true